A new sesquiterpene lactone and secoguaianolides from Achillea cretica L. growing in Tunisia

A phytochemical investigation of the aerial parts of Achillea cretica L. led to the isolation of a new chlorine-containing sesquiterpene lactone (1) together with two new epimeric secoguaianolides of tanaphallin (2a,b) and the known vomifoliol (3). Their structures were elucidated by extensive application of one- and two-dimensional NMR spectroscopy and by comparison with authentic samples. Sesquiterpenes lactones are known to have great variety of pharmacological and biological activities such as antimicrobial, cytotoxic, antiviral, anti-inflammatory. Their great potential biological activities have more interest among chemists to the drug discovery research. In the present work, the isolates were tested for their cytotoxic activities against four different human cancer cell lines, HCT-116, IGROV-1, OVCAR-3 and MCF-7 using MTT assay. Compound 1 was found to be the most cytotoxic against the four tested cell lines with a relatively high selectivity against OVCAR-3 (IC50 = 23.0 ± 2.0 μM).
